System.Reflection.TypeExtensions 4.3.0-preview1-24530-04
Provides extensions methods for System.Type that are designed to be source-compatible with older framework reflection-based APIs.
Commonly Used Types:
System.Reflection.TypeExtensions
System.Reflection.BindingFlags
 
When using NuGet 3.x this package requires at least version 3.4.
                    Showing the top 20 packages that depend on System.Reflection.TypeExtensions.
| Packages | Downloads | 
|---|---|
| 
                                                    log4net
                                                     log4net is a tool to help the programmer output log statements to a variety of output targets.
      In case of problems with an application, it is helpful to enable logging so that the problem 
      can be located. With log4net it is possible to enable logging at runtime without modifying the
      application binary. The log4net package is designed so that log statements can remain in 
      shipped code without incurring a high performance cost. It follows that the speed of logging
      (or rather not logging) is crucial.
      At the same time, log output can be so voluminous that it quickly becomes overwhelming.
      One of the distinctive features of log4net is the notion of hierarchical loggers.
      Using these loggers it is possible to selectively control which log statements are output
      at arbitrary granularity.
      log4net is designed with two distinct goals in mind: speed and flexibility 
                                                 | 
                                                210 | 
| 
                                                    Microsoft.NETCore
                                                     Provides a set of packages that can be used when building portable libraries on .NETCore based platforms. \r\n TFS ID: 1599443, GitHub SHA: https://github.com/dotnet/corefx/tree/eede273a4dfabcea608621f5e1bbf8ad00584cfb 
                                                 | 
                                                163 | 
| 
                                                    log4net
                                                     log4net is a tool to help the programmer output log statements to a variety of output targets. In case of problems with an application, it is helpful to enable logging so that the problem can be located. With log4net it is possible to enable logging at runtime without modifying the application binary. The log4net package is designed so that log statements can remain in shipped code without incurring a high performance cost. It follows that the speed of logging (or rather not logging) is crucial.
      At the same time, log output can be so voluminous that it quickly becomes overwhelming. One of the distinctive features of log4net is the notion of hierarchical loggers. Using these loggers it is possible to selectively control which log statements are output at arbitrary granularity.
      log4net is designed with two distinct goals in mind: speed and flexibility 
                                                 | 
                                                158 | 
| 
                                                    log4net
                                                     log4net is a tool to help the programmer output log statements to a variety of output targets. In case of problems with an application, it is helpful to enable logging so that the problem can be located. With log4net it is possible to enable logging at runtime without modifying the application binary. The log4net package is designed so that log statements can remain in shipped code without incurring a high performance cost. It follows that the speed of logging (or rather not logging) is crucial.
      At the same time, log output can be so voluminous that it quickly becomes overwhelming. One of the distinctive features of log4net is the notion of hierarchical loggers. Using these loggers it is possible to selectively control which log statements are output at arbitrary granularity.
      log4net is designed with two distinct goals in mind: speed and flexibility 
                                                 | 
                                                153 | 
| 
                                                    log4net
                                                     log4net is a tool to help the programmer output log statements to a variety of output targets. In case of problems with an application, it is helpful to enable logging so that the problem can be located. With log4net it is possible to enable logging at runtime without modifying the application binary. The log4net package is designed so that log statements can remain in shipped code without incurring a high performance cost. It follows that the speed of logging (or rather not logging) is crucial. 
At the same time, log output can be so voluminous that it quickly becomes overwhelming. One of the distinctive features of log4net is the notion of hierarchical loggers. Using these loggers it is possible to selectively control which log statements are output at arbitrary granularity. 
log4net is designed with two distinct goals in mind: speed and flexibility 
                                                 | 
                                                144 | 
| 
                                                    Google.Apis
                                                     The Google APIs Client Library is a runtime client for working with Google services.
The library supports service requests, media upload and download, etc.
    
Supported Platforms:
- .NET Framework 4.5+
- NetStandard1.3, providing .NET Core support 
                                                 | 
                                                142 | 
| 
                                                    log4net
                                                     log4net is a tool to help the programmer output log statements to a variety of output targets. In case of problems with an application, it is helpful to enable logging so that the problem can be located. With log4net it is possible to enable logging at runtime without modifying the application binary. The log4net package is designed so that log statements can remain in shipped code without incurring a high performance cost. It follows that the speed of logging (or rather not logging) is crucial. 
At the same time, log output can be so voluminous that it quickly becomes overwhelming. One of the distinctive features of log4net is the notion of hierarchical loggers. Using these loggers it is possible to selectively control which log statements are output at arbitrary granularity. 
log4net is designed with two distinct goals in mind: speed and flexibility 
                                                 | 
                                                141 | 
| 
                                                    Microsoft.CSharp
                                                     Provides support for compilation and code generation, including dynamic, using the C# language.
Commonly Used Types:
Microsoft.CSharp.RuntimeBinder.Binder
Microsoft.CSharp.RuntimeBinder.RuntimeBinderException
Microsoft.CSharp.RuntimeBinder.CSharpArgumentInfo
Microsoft.CSharp.RuntimeBinder.CSharpArgumentInfoFlags
Microsoft.CSharp.RuntimeBinder.CSharpBinderFlags
 
When using NuGet 3.x this package requires at least version 3.4. 
                                                 | 
                                                141 | 
| 
                                                    System.Linq.Expressions
                                                     Provides classes, interfaces and enumerations that enable language-level code expressions to be represented as objects in the form of expression trees.
Commonly Used Types:
System.Linq.IQueryable<T>
System.Linq.IQueryable
System.Linq.Expressions.Expression<TDelegate>
System.Linq.Expressions.Expression
System.Linq.Expressions.ExpressionVisitor
 
When using NuGet 3.x this package requires at least version 3.4. 
                                                 | 
                                                140 | 
| 
                                                    Microsoft.CSharp
                                                     Provides support for compilation and code generation, including dynamic, using the C# language.
Commonly Used Types:
Microsoft.CSharp.RuntimeBinder.Binder
Microsoft.CSharp.RuntimeBinder.RuntimeBinderException
Microsoft.CSharp.RuntimeBinder.CSharpArgumentInfo
Microsoft.CSharp.RuntimeBinder.CSharpArgumentInfoFlags
Microsoft.CSharp.RuntimeBinder.CSharpBinderFlags
 
When using NuGet 3.x this package requires at least version 3.4. 
                                                 | 
                                                137 | 
| 
                                                    Google.Apis
                                                     The Google APIs Client Library is a runtime client for working with Google services.
The library supports service requests, media upload and download, etc.
    
Supported Platforms:
- .NET Framework 4.5+
- NetStandard1.3, providing .NET Core support 
                                                 | 
                                                135 | 
| 
                                                    Microsoft.CSharp
                                                     Provides support for compilation and code generation, including dynamic, using the C# language.
Commonly Used Types:
Microsoft.CSharp.RuntimeBinder.Binder
Microsoft.CSharp.RuntimeBinder.RuntimeBinderException
Microsoft.CSharp.RuntimeBinder.CSharpArgumentInfo
Microsoft.CSharp.RuntimeBinder.CSharpArgumentInfoFlags
Microsoft.CSharp.RuntimeBinder.CSharpBinderFlags
 
When using NuGet 3.x this package requires at least version 3.4. 
                                                 | 
                                                133 | 
| 
                                                    System.ComponentModel.TypeConverter
                                                     Provides the System.ComponentModel.TypeConverter class, which represents a unified way of converting types of values to other types.
Commonly Used Types:
System.ComponentModel.TypeConverter
System.ComponentModel.TypeConverterAttribute
System.ComponentModel.PropertyDescriptor
System.ComponentModel.StringConverter
System.ComponentModel.ITypeDescriptorContext
System.ComponentModel.EnumConverter
System.ComponentModel.TypeDescriptor
System.ComponentModel.Int32Converter
System.ComponentModel.BooleanConverter
System.ComponentModel.DoubleConverter
 
When using NuGet 3.x this package requires at least version 3.4. 
                                                 | 
                                                132 | 
| 
                                                    log4net
                                                     log4net is a tool to help the programmer output log statements to a variety of output targets. In case of problems with an application, it is helpful to enable logging so that the problem can be located. With log4net it is possible to enable logging at runtime without modifying the application binary. The log4net package is designed so that log statements can remain in shipped code without incurring a high performance cost. It follows that the speed of logging (or rather not logging) is crucial.
      At the same time, log output can be so voluminous that it quickly becomes overwhelming. One of the distinctive features of log4net is the notion of hierarchical loggers. Using these loggers it is possible to selectively control which log statements are output at arbitrary granularity.
      log4net is designed with two distinct goals in mind: speed and flexibility 
                                                 | 
                                                128 | 
| 
                                                    Google.Apis
                                                     The Google APIs Client Library is a runtime client for working with Google services.
The library supports service requests, media upload and download, etc.
    
Supported Platforms:
- .NET Framework 4.5+
- NetStandard1.3, providing .NET Core support 
                                                 | 
                                                128 | 
| 
                                                    Microsoft.DotNet.PlatformAbstractions
                                                     Abstractions for making code that uses file system and environment testable. 
                                                 | 
                                                127 | 
| 
                                                    System.Dynamic.Runtime
                                                     Provides classes and interfaces that support the Dynamic Language Runtime (DLR).
Commonly Used Types:
System.Runtime.CompilerServices.CallSite
System.Runtime.CompilerServices.CallSite<T>
System.Dynamic.IDynamicMetaObjectProvider
System.Dynamic.DynamicMetaObject
System.Dynamic.SetMemberBinder
System.Dynamic.GetMemberBinder
System.Dynamic.ExpandoObject
System.Dynamic.DynamicObject
System.Runtime.CompilerServices.CallSiteBinder
System.Runtime.CompilerServices.ConditionalWeakTable<TKey, TValue>
 
When using NuGet 3.x this package requires at least version 3.4. 
                                                 | 
                                                125 | 
| 
                                                    log4net
                                                     log4net is a tool to help the programmer output log statements to a variety of output targets. In case of problems with an application, it is helpful to enable logging so that the problem can be located. With log4net it is possible to enable logging at runtime without modifying the application binary. The log4net package is designed so that log statements can remain in shipped code without incurring a high performance cost. It follows that the speed of logging (or rather not logging) is crucial.
      At the same time, log output can be so voluminous that it quickly becomes overwhelming. One of the distinctive features of log4net is the notion of hierarchical loggers. Using these loggers it is possible to selectively control which log statements are output at arbitrary granularity.
      log4net is designed with two distinct goals in mind: speed and flexibility 
                                                 | 
                                                125 | 
| 
                                                    System.Linq.Expressions
                                                     Provides classes, interfaces and enumerations that enable language-level code expressions to be represented as objects in the form of expression trees.
Commonly Used Types:
System.Linq.Expressions.Expression<TDelegate>
System.Linq.Expressions.Expression
System.Linq.Expressions.MemberExpression
System.Linq.Expressions.ExpressionVisitor
System.Linq.Expressions.MethodCallExpression
System.Linq.IQueryable<T>
System.Linq.IQueryable
System.Linq.Expressions.NewExpression
System.Linq.Expressions.ParameterExpression
System.Linq.Expressions.ConstantExpression 
                                                 | 
                                                125 | 
| 
                                                    log4net
                                                     log4net is a tool to help the programmer output log statements to a variety of output targets.
      In case of problems with an application, it is helpful to enable logging so that the problem 
      can be located. With log4net it is possible to enable logging at runtime without modifying the
      application binary. The log4net package is designed so that log statements can remain in 
      shipped code without incurring a high performance cost. It follows that the speed of logging
      (or rather not logging) is crucial.
      At the same time, log output can be so voluminous that it quickly becomes overwhelming.
      One of the distinctive features of log4net is the notion of hierarchical loggers.
      Using these loggers it is possible to selectively control which log statements are output
      at arbitrary granularity.
      log4net is designed with two distinct goals in mind: speed and flexibility 
                                                 | 
                                                124 | 
MonoAndroid 1.0
- No dependencies.
 
Xamarin.WatchOS 1.0
- No dependencies.
 
Xamarin.TVOS 1.0
- No dependencies.
 
Xamarin.Mac 2.0
- No dependencies.
 
Xamarin.iOS 1.0
- No dependencies.
 
.NET Standard 1.5
- System.Reflection (>= 4.3.0-preview1-24530-04)
 - System.Runtime (>= 4.3.0-preview1-24530-04)
 
.NET Standard 1.3
- System.Runtime (>= 4.3.0-preview1-24530-04)
 - System.Reflection (>= 4.3.0-preview1-24530-04)
 
.NETCore 5.0
- System.Runtime.Extensions (>= 4.3.0-preview1-24530-04)
 - System.Runtime (>= 4.3.0-preview1-24530-04)
 - System.Reflection.Primitives (>= 4.3.0-preview1-24530-04)
 - System.Reflection (>= 4.3.0-preview1-24530-04)
 - System.Linq (>= 4.3.0-preview1-24530-04)
 - System.Diagnostics.Debug (>= 4.3.0-preview1-24530-04)
 - System.Resources.ResourceManager (>= 4.3.0-preview1-24530-04)
 - System.Diagnostics.Contracts (>= 4.3.0-preview1-24530-04)
 
.NET Framework 4.6.2
- System.Reflection (>= 4.3.0-preview1-24530-04)
 
.NET Framework 4.6
- No dependencies.
 
MonoTouch 1.0
- No dependencies.